Pleasanton Ghost Walk Tickets On Sale

Explore some of downtown Pleasanton's most haunted locations, complete with re-enactments and Electromagnetic Field Readers.

PLEASANTON, CA — Tickets are on sale for the Museum of Main's delightfully spooky Annual Ghost Walk of downtown Pleasanton.

During the weekends of Oct. 10-11 and Oct. 17-18, guests can take tours of Pleasanton's most haunted locations led by trained Ghosts Hosts. The family-friendly tour will explain some of the paranormal activities experienced at different sights and locations around town. Ghost Hosts will also carry a K2 Electromagnetic Field Meter, which detects spikes in the electromagnetic field. Some believe they can detect paranormal activity or communication.

At each haunted location, actors will play the roles of various ghosts.

"The Ghost Walk at Museum on Main is a Halloween tradition in Pleasanton and is a fun way to explore Pleasanton’s history through its ghosts," said Museum on Main Director of Education Peter Wallis. "This walk brings stories and experiences collected and documented from locals over the years. The Ghost Walk integrates history and personal accounts into an event that is sure to get you into the Halloween spirit."

Tours begin at the Museum on Main and leave every 30 minutes from 6 p.m. to 8 p.m. See here or call 925-462-2766 to purchase tickets, which cost $25 for adults and $20 for children 12 and under.
